The Kentucky Transportation Cabinet and the Federal Highway Administration are holding a public meeting this week to discuss reconstruction of the I-69 / I-24 interchange at Calvert City.
The interchange is part of the larger project to improve Kentucky highways for the Interstate 69 corridor.
KYTC District 1 Chief Engineer Mike McGregor will be available at the informal meeting and allow community members to speak with project coordinators, view designs for the full flow interchange and comment on the project.

“This revised design maintains the direct connection between the existing Purchase Parkway and U.S. 62 at Calvert City," said McGregor. "This is in response to public comments made prior to our first public meeting on this project. We were fortunate that the FHWA was willing to approve a plan to maintain the direct connection to U.S. 62 for Calvert City.”
